HPQ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2014 in Review

901 of the 3,463 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in HP (HPQ) for Q1 2014, worth a combined $47.2B — up 15% from $41.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 101 funds opened new HPQ positions and 65 closed out — a net gain of 36 holders — while 277 added to existing stakes and 387 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Primecap Management, adding an estimated $530M. The largest seller was Capital Research Global Investors, cutting an estimated $370M.
